The French Republic or Republique
Francaise is located in Western Europe and shares
boundaries with Andorra, Belgium, Germany, Italy,
Luxembourg and Switzerland France is flanked
by the English Channel.
France
is approximately 547,030 sq km and has an estimated
population of 60 million people it’s famous worldwide for it’s
fabulous food, wine, architecture, passionate
people, sexy language and the Eiffel Tower.

French
food is world renowned they originally adapted
the tradition of eating different courses separately
with hors d'oeuvre for starters (or small lunch)
then soup, main course, salad, cheese and deserts.
They are famous for their mouth-watering gourmet
cooking but also for some of their more adventurous
cooking e.g. horse, brain, tripe, blood sauces
and sausages, sheep’s foot, tongue, snails
and frog legs.
Removals To Paris
Also known as the City of Light, Paris is an
architectural wonder with many points of interest
and world famous landmarks. Paris is approximately
41 square miles and has a population of 2.2
million, and attracts 20 million tourists each
year.

A
visit to Paris is filled with architecture,
arts, culture, history, shopping and Disneyland.
Paris also has many famous landmarks including
the Eiffel Tower, Champs Élysées,
which leads to l’Arc De Triomphe, also
the La Place de la Concorde, the Louvre, and
Pompidou is the grandiose Notre Dame.

Removals To Marseille
France’s third largest and oldest city
is not a popular tourist destination. The Greeks
and Romans conquered it and there are a profusion
of sites and artefacts to be found. The city
was established in 600 B.C., and is the countries
largest commercial port.
France has much to offer any tourist or resident,
there is over 1500 miles of coastline and rural
France is divided into 22 regions Alsace, Aquitaine,
Auvergne, Basse-Normandie, Bourgogne, Bretagne,
Centre, Champagne-Ardenne, Corse, Franche-Comte,
Haute-Normandie, Ile-de-France, Languedoc-Roussillon,
Limousin, Lorraine, Midi-Pyrenees, Norde-Pas-de-Calais,
pays-de-la-Loirre, Picardie, Poitou- Charentes,
Provence-Alpes-Cote D’Azur, Rhones-Alpes.
